EFEKTIFITAS RELAKSASI OTOT PROGRESIF DALAM MENURUNKAN KECEMASAN: TINJAUAN LITERATUR
The Effectiveness of Progressive Muscle Relaxation in Reducing Anxiety: A Literature Review

Pendahuluan: Kecemasan adalah masalah psikologis yang ditemukan pada orang dewasa yang lebih tua dimana mencapai 40% dari orang dewasa yang lebih tua mengalami kecemasan , kecemasan dikaitkan dengan cacat fisik, penurunan status fungsional, penurunan kepuasan hidup, kualitas hidup yang lebih rendah, peningkatan kesepian, dan peningkatan mortalitas.
Tujuan: Tujuan studi ini adalah untuk mengetahui pengaruh latihan relaksasi otot progresif terhadap kecemasan pasien
Metode: Studi ini merupakan jenis literature review. Dalam pencarian artikel, kami menggunakan database elektronik. Artikel yang kami review adalah artikel publikasi sepuluh tahun terakhir.
Hasil: Dari hasil review terlihat bahwa keseluruhan hasil penelitian menjelaskan bahwa latihan relaksasi otot progresif dalam menurunkan kecemasan, efektivitas latihan relaksasi otot progresif dalam menurunkan kecemasan memiliki tingkat keberhasilan hingga 84 %.
Kesimpulan: Dalam pengaplikasian relaksasi otot progresif pada semua artikel penelitian terdapat penurunan tingkat kecemasan pada pasien dengan berbagai macam penyakit, selain penurunan kecemasan relaksasi otot progresif juga dapat berefek juga pada peningkatan koping pasien.
